CMD INVESTS £1/4 MILLION IN NEW MACHINE AS PART OF FACTORY UPGRADE

We have invested in a new £1/4m TRUMPF CNC metal punch as part of an asset renewal strategy for our UK manufacturing capability. The new machine will be used in the production of a wide variety of our power distribution systems and workstation power products at our Rotherham factory. CMD Ltd PLAYS ESSENTIAL ROLE IN ELECTRICAL FIT OUT AT LONDON’S PRESTIGIOUS OFFICE DEVELOPMENT

CMD Ltd, specialist in workplace connectivity and ergonomic solutions, has provided a flexible and high-quality power distribution network for The Ray, a prestigious office development in London’s Farringdon. Well-known for being the former site of The Guardian newspaper, The Ray now stands as an 83,000ft² office development characterised by a modernised warehouse aesthetic, with level two now occupied by a global social media company. Overview of Battery Tablet Press Machines and Their Importance

Battery tablet press machines play a critical role in the production of battery components. These machines efficiently compress powders into tablet form, ensuring consistency and quality. This is essential for maintaining battery performance and lifespan. The manufacturing process leverages advanced technology to optimize production and reduce waste.

When selecting a battery tablet press machine, consider several factors. Capacity is vital. Ensure the machine can handle your production volume. Precision is equally important. Machines should deliver uniform pressure for consistent tablet quality. Analyze the ease of maintenance as well. Regular upkeep can prevent costly downtimes.

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Battery Tablet Press Machine

Choosing the right battery tablet press machine involves several key features. First, consider the machine's compression force. A higher force allows for denser tablets. This is vital for producing high-quality batteries. Look at the die and punch design. They must be suitable for your specific formulations. Different materials require various shapes and sizes.

Another critical aspect is the machine's automation level. An automated process minimizes human error and improves efficiency. Check for features like touchscreen controls and programmable settings. These enhance usability and allow for quick adjustments during production runs.

Lastly, evaluate maintenance requirements. Machines that are easy to clean and service save time and reduce downtime. Regular maintenance ensures consistent performance. Balancing these factors can lead to a more effective production process. Selecting a machine is complex, but focusing on these features makes it manageable.

Maintenance and Best Practices for Battery Tablet Press Machines

Battery tablet press machines play a critical role in the manufacturing of battery components. Maintaining these machines is vital for longevity and efficiency. Regular cleaning is essential. Dust and residue can lead to malfunctions and reduce output quality. Check the machine’s hydraulic systems periodically. Look for leaks or unusual noises that might indicate issues.

Proper lubrication of moving parts promotes smooth operation. Create a schedule for lubrication to avoid forgetting. Insufficient lubrication can result in wear and tear, decreasing your machine's lifespan. It's beneficial to document maintenance activities. This documentation provides insight into when issues arise, helping teams stay proactive.

Training operators is also crucial. A well-trained operator can identify problems early. They should understand the machine’s specifications and limitations.
